This pull request splits the developer documentation into `CONTRIBUTING.md` and `DEVELOPING.md`. `CONTRIBUTING.md` now contains an additional paragraph, instructing contributors to create an issue before submitting a pull request. The introduction of this additional step was discussed at this year's FOSS4G conference. This new step would also affect contributions from core developers.

# Developing | ||
|
||
## Setting up development environment | ||
|
||
You will obviously start by | ||
[forking](https://github.com/openlayers/ol3/fork) the ol3 repository. | ||
|
||
### Travis CI | ||
|
||
The Travis CI hook is enabled on the Github repository. This means every pull request | ||
is run through a full test suite to ensure it compiles and passes the tests. Failing | ||
pull requests will not be merged. | ||
|
||
Although not mandatory, it is also recommended to set up Travis CI for your ol3 fork. | ||
For that go to your ol3 fork's Service Hooks page and set up the Travis hook. | ||
Then every time you push to your fork, the test suite will be run. This means | ||
errors can be caught before creating a pull request. For those making | ||
small or occasional contributions, this may be enough to check that your contributions | ||
are ok; in this case, you do not need to install the build tools on your local environment | ||
as described below. | ||
|
||
### Development dependencies | ||
|
||
The minimum requirements are: | ||
|
||
* GNU Make | ||
* Git | ||
* [Node.js](http://nodejs.org/) (0.10.x or higher) | ||
* Python 2.6 or 2.7 with a couple of extra modules (see below) | ||
* Java 7 (JRE and JDK) | ||
|
||
The executables `git`, `node`, `python` and `java` should be in your `PATH`. | ||
|
||
You can check your configuration by running: | ||
|
||
$ make check-deps | ||
|
||
To install the Node.js dependencies run | ||
|
||
$ npm install | ||
|
||
To install the extra Python modules, run: | ||
|
||
$ sudo pip install -r requirements.txt | ||
or | ||
|
||
$ cat requirements.txt | sudo xargs easy_install | ||
|
||
depending on your OS and Python installation. | ||
|
||
(You can also install the Python modules in a Python virtual environment if you want to.) | ||
|
||
## Working with the build tool | ||
|
||
As an ol3 developer you will use `make` to run build targets defined in the | ||
`Makefile` located at the root of the repository. The `Makefile` includes | ||
targets for running the linter, the compiler, the tests, etc. | ||
|
||
The usage of `make` is as follows: | ||
|
||
$ make <target> | ||
|
||
where `<target>` is the name of the build target you want to execute. For | ||
example: | ||
|
||
$ make test | ||
|
||
The main build targets are `serve`, `lint`, `build`, `test`, and `check`. The | ||
latter is a meta-target that basically runs `lint`, `build`, and `test`. | ||
|
||
The `serve` target starts a node-based web server, which we will refer to as the *dev server*. You'll need to start that server for running the examples and the tests in a browser. More information on that further down. | ||
|
||
Other targets include `apidoc` and `ci`. The latter is the target used on Travis CI. See ol3's [Travis configuration file](https://github.com/openlayers/ol3/blob/master/.travis.yml). | ||
|
||
## Running the `check` target | ||
|
||
The `check` target is to be run before pushing code to GitHub and opening pull | ||
requests. Branches that don't pass `check` won't pass the integration tests, | ||
and have therefore no chance of being merged into `master`. | ||
|
||
To run the `check` target: | ||
|
||
$ make check | ||
|
||
If you want to run the full suite of integration tests, see "Running the integration | ||
tests" below. | ||
|
||
## Running examples | ||
|
||
To run the examples you first need to start the dev server: | ||
|
||
$ make serve | ||
|
||
Then, just point your browser <http://localhost:3000/build/examples> in your browser. For example <http://localhost:3000/build/examples/side-by-side.html>. | ||
|
||
Run examples against the `ol.js` standalone build: | ||
|
||
The examples can also be run against the `ol.js` standalone build, just like | ||
the examples [hosted](http://openlayers.org/en/master/examples/) on GitHub. | ||
Start by executing the `host-examples` build target: | ||
|
||
$ make host-examples | ||
|
||
After running `host-examples` you can now open the examples index page in the browser: <http://localhost:3000/build/hosted/master/examples/>. (This assumes that you still have the dev server running.) | ||
|
||
Append `?mode=raw` to make the example work in full debug mode. In raw mode the OpenLayers and Closure Library scripts are loaded individually by the Closure Library's `base.js` script (which the example page loads and executes before any other script). | ||
|
||
## Running tests | ||
|
||
To run the tests in a browser start the dev server (`make serve`) and open <http://localhost:3000/test/index.html> in the browser. | ||
|
||
To run the tests on the console (headless testing with PhantomJS) use the `test` target: | ||
|
||
$ make test | ||
|
||
See also the test-specific [README](../master/test/README.md). | ||
|
||
## Running the integration tests | ||
|
||
When you submit a pull request the [Travis continuous integration | ||
server](https://travis-ci.org/) will run a full suite of tests, including | ||
building all versions of the library and checking that all of the examples | ||
work. You will receive an email with the results, and the status will be | ||
displayed in the pull request. | ||
|
||
To run the full suite of integration tests use the `ci` target: | ||
|
||
$ make ci | ||
|
||
Running the full suite of integration tests currently takes 5-10 minutes. | ||
|
||
This makes sure that your commit won't break the build. It also runs JSDoc3 to | ||
make sure that there are no invalid API doc directives. | ||
|
||
## Adding examples | ||
|
||
Adding functionality often implies adding one or several examples. This | ||
section provides explanations related to adding examples. | ||
|
||
The examples are located in the `examples` directory. Adding a new example | ||
implies creating two or three files in this directory, an `.html` file, a `.js` | ||
file, and, optionally, a `.css` file. | ||
|
||
You can use `simple.js` and `simple.html` as templates for new examples. | ||
|
||
### Use of the `goog` namespace in examples | ||
|
||
Short story: the ol3 examples should not use the `goog` namespace, except | ||
for `goog.require`. | ||
|
||
Longer story: we want that the ol3 examples work in multiple modes, with the | ||
standalone lib (which has implications of the symbols and properties we | ||
export), and compiled together with the ol3 library. | ||
|
||
Compiling the examples together with the library makes it mandatory to declare dependencies with `goog.require` statements. |
